导读 | IP地址?子网掩码? 网关?咱们常常混淆这些知识,同时面试的时候又容易被问。下面咱们就一个一个的来介绍他们的区别和用途。 |
网络无处不在,深深影响着咱们的生活。而下面几点知识是咱们在网络学习中常常遇到的,但并非每一个人都能轻易的说出他们概念。
IP地址?子网掩码? 网关?咱们常常混淆这些知识,同时面试的时候又容易被问。
通俗一句话就是:IP 地址,是来标注你这台电脑的身份的,就如同咱们每一个人都有一个身份证通常;子网掩码表示所使用的网络属于哪中网络段,两个IP地址同属于一个网段就能够直接通讯 ,当属于不一样的网络段时则须要网关来发挥做用了;而网关指的是所发送的信息(数据包)出去的出口,通常指的是路由器的地址。
下面咱们就一个一个的来介绍他们的区别和用途。html
1. IP地址linux
(1) 什么是IP协议/地址?面试
即“网络之间能相互连通的协议”,即计算机与计算机之间借助网络的相互通讯都得遵循IP协议。 打个比方吧,你开车容许你上高速公路,那么你的车辆就必须得上牌照,若是别人的车辆也上了牌照。那么你们均可以上高速公路。车辆没上牌照的就不能上公路了。而在这里这个IP协议,就至关于车辆须要安装的牌照。网络
(2) IP协议的位置?学习
在OSI(网络七层模型)中位于“网络层”一处。翻译
(3) IP协议的组成?htm
它将数据链路层传来的数据帧打包成“IP数据包”的格式来传递到下一层blog
(4) IP地址是什么?路由
IP地址 = 网格号 + 主机号, 组成的。
IP地址的分类(以下图所示):
这样解释IP地址、子网掩码、网关之间的联系,不会技术也能听懂
IP的五类地址get
(5) IP地址的用途
IP地址是用来标识每台计算机的身份,它为互联网上的每台计算机分配一个逻辑地址,标识这台计算机的惟一。 即计算机的网络身份证。
2. 子网掩码
这样解释IP地址、子网掩码、网关之间的联系,不会技术也能听懂
(1) 子网掩码的含义:
什么叫作子网掩码?子网掩码就是用来判断两台计算机的IP地址是否属于同一个网络段的判断。若是两台计算机处于同一个网络字段上的娿,则这两台计算机就能够直接进行通讯交流。
(2) 子网掩码的组成:
由32位的二进制组成,例如:
子网掩码二进制 :
11111111 . 11111111 . 11111111 . 00000000 即表示为: 255 .255 . 255 . 0
(3) 子网掩码的用途:
屏蔽IP地址的一部分用来表示区别是 网络标识和主机标识,以此来判断出IP地址是在局域网仍是,Internet网上
将整个巨大的IP 网络划分红若干个小的子网,除此以外经过计算机的子网掩码,能够判断出两台计算机是不是处在同一个网络段的。
即将计算机的IP地址和子网掩码都转化为二进制,进行AND运算,得出结果相同的话,则说明两台计算机处在同一个网络段,能够直接通讯。
3. 网关
这样解释IP地址、子网掩码、网关之间的联系,不会技术也能听懂
(1) 什么叫作网关呢?
打个比方:在古代咱们从一个地方到另外一个地方,须要通过一个城门口,好比说从东北进入内地须要通过 山海关。这个城门口叫作“关口“。那么一样道理而言,从一个网络通道进入另外一个网络通道是,也必需要经历这样的一个“关口”,在这里咱们称之为 网关。即从一个网络链接进入另外一个网络的“入口“。
通俗意义上的理解:
网关: 一般指默认网关,好比上面说的经过子网掩码判断出两台计算机处于不一样的网络字段,两台计算机就不能直接进行通讯,那么咱们是否是就不能痛心了啊。为了能进行通讯,这个时候网关就出现了,能够将不一样网络频段的两台计算机联系在一块儿,从而进行通讯。
(2) 网关的用处?
好比如今有 网络一 和网络而 两个网络,而
这样解释IP地址、子网掩码、网关之间的联系,不会技术也能听懂
若是两个网络之间要是没有路由器的话,网络一和网络二 之间是不能进行TCP/IP 的通讯的。由于根据上面的子网掩码咱们判断出网络一和网络二 ,是处于不一样的网络,所以在现实中,要使两个网络能够互相连通,则必须经过网关。
网关是处在网络层方面的知识,当两个处于不一样网络字段的计算机,想要进行联系,就必须通过网关。
打个比方:你和一个美国人进行交流,而你不懂英语,美国人也不懂汉语,那怎么办?大家互相说话的话,都是没法交流的。 这时,咱们能够借助于一个翻译机,能够将对方所说的话翻译成我所能听得懂的语言。这样就能够了,网关的做用也是这样的,两个不一样网络频段的计算机,通过网关(网关须要靠路由器来实现协议做用)能够进行无障碍的交流通讯。
4. 总结:
IP地址,是用来标注你这台电脑的身份的,就如同咱们每一个人都有一个身份证通常;子网掩码表示计算机使用的网络属于哪中网络段,两个IP地址同属于一个网段就能够直接通讯 ,当属于不一样的网络段时则须要网关来发挥做用了;而网关指的是处于不一样网络段的计算机联系在一块儿,可让他们进行互相通讯,网关须要依靠路由器来完成它的功能。
本文地址:https://www.linuxprobe.com/overview-of-network-foundation.html